Got it! Despite playing in only four games during the pandemic-shortened season, the Sun Devil defense stacked up statistically other top defenses. ASU was the first nationally in turnover margin, forcing 13 total turnovers compared to just five for the opponent.

The Sun Devils finished first in the Pac in scoring defense Defensive back Evan Fields four forced fumbles led the conference and was tied for first in the country. Local products defensive back Chase Lucas and defensive lineman Tyler Johnson each earned second-team All-Pac honors, while three more members of the Sun Devil defense earned conference honorable mention notice: defensive lineman Jermayne Lole, linebacker Kyle Soelle, and Fields.

The seven playoff berths the Bengals achieved with Lewis equaled the number the club had in the 35 seasons prior to his arrival. Under Lewis, the Bengals were one of only four NFL teams to reach the playoffs every year from Named the ninth head coach in Bengals history on Jan. Lewis coached 21 Pro Bowl players during his time in Cincinnati, with nine of those players earning the honor multiple times.

In , defensive tackle Geno Atkins earned his seventh Pro Bowl nod, the most ever by a Bengals defensive player. In Lewis was hired on as the linebackers coach for the New Mexico Lobos football team under the teams new head coach, Mike Sheppard.

During his time with the school the team went his first season and the remaining two, the worst the team had done in 18 years. After the season ended, he left New Mexico and was hired on by Pittsburgh. The Pittsburgh Panthers hired Lewis to be their new linebackers coach in where he would remain until the end of the season. The team had slight improvement the next year, posting a record of in his final season with Pittsburgh.

Lewis got his grand entrance to the NFL in with the Pittsburgh Steelers as their new linebackers coach. The final year he was with the team they made it to the Super Bowl versus the Dallas Cowboys and lost He left the team early for a job opportunity in Baltimore.

Lewis got his first big break since coming to the NFL in , when he was hired on by the Baltimore Ravens as their defensive coordinator. The team set a record for fewest points allowed in a 16 game season with just , averaging out at
